About this tag
The Qwen AI tag on WindowsForum.com covers discussions about Alibaba's open-source Qwen family of large language models, including the Qwen2.5-Max Mixture-of-Experts flagship. Topics include Qwen's global rise as a competitor to proprietary models like GPT-5, its impact on enterprise AI strategies, developer toolchains, and the open-source AI landscape. The tag also explores how Qwen is reshaping vendor strategies and providing alternatives for businesses evaluating AI solutions. Content focuses on the technical and strategic implications of Qwen's development and adoption.
